Sightseeing down the Seward Highway along the majestic Turnagain Arm. See native wildlife up close in a beautiful natural setting at the Alaska Wildlife Conservation Center, home to a large variety of brown bears, black bears, moose, caribou, wolves, musk ox, lynx, and wood bison. You might see many or most of these during the visit.

The tour does not require much walking. But we recommend wearing comfortable shoes and weather-appropriate clothing.
Expect temperatures ranging from the mid-50s to the mid-70s F (10 - 25 C), or warmer. Dress in layers and always prepare for rain and wind. Our vans have plenty of room to bring an extra jacket and hat. It’s always advisable to wear sunglasses and bring along sunscreen and insect repellent.
We have and are able to successfully accommodate guests with reduced mobility and/or who require assistance walking (walkers, canes, etc.). However, our fleet is not equipped to accommodate those who are wheelchair-bound. Please note that some of the stops along the tour are not paved.
